WorkspaceAr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"xujaflclaqdqxaja")
suspend fun accountAccessType(value: WorkspaceAccountAccessType?)
@JvmName(name = "uaepejdauhwdqrbg")
suspend fun accountAccessType(value: Output<WorkspaceAccountAccessType>)
Link copied to clipboard
@JvmName(name = "ndrnkrqbvckxedtv")
suspend fun authenticationProviders(value: Output<List<WorkspaceAuthenticationProviderTypes>>)
@JvmName(name = "vkpkffpqyfvqvhly")
suspend fun authenticationProviders(vararg values: WorkspaceAuthenticationProviderTypes)
@JvmName(name = "unnythkbomhfnvul")
suspend fun authenticationProviders(vararg values: Output<WorkspaceAuthenticationProviderTypes>)
@JvmName(name = "ssdgxiuvtwnucshk")
suspend fun authenticationProviders(value: List<WorkspaceAuthenticationProviderTypes>?)
@JvmName(name = "vexvjguswfltknfw")
suspend fun authenticationProviders(values: List<Output<WorkspaceAuthenticationProviderTypes>>)
Link copied to clipboard
@JvmName(name = "oswbgpxhiqjsrpws")
suspend fun clientToken(value: Output<String>)
@JvmName(name = "swosorvhavumagbv")
suspend fun clientToken(value: String?)
Link copied to clipboard
@JvmName(name = "ofbtevifqqlawhvr")
suspend fun dataSources(value: Output<List<WorkspaceDataSourceType>>)
@JvmName(name = "iscxemlbljyaudbb")
suspend fun dataSources(vararg values: WorkspaceDataSourceType)
@JvmName(name = "bfnrgtqsnmxugxio")
suspend fun dataSources(vararg values: Output<WorkspaceDataSourceType>)
@JvmName(name = "vivaehqrbtnvqrpo")
suspend fun dataSources(value: List<WorkspaceDataSourceType>?)
@JvmName(name = "btjmujoebchctulq")
suspend fun dataSources(values: List<Output<WorkspaceDataSourceType>>)
Link copied to clipboard
@JvmName(name = "hstcalfayvjrnphj")
suspend fun description(value: Output<String>)
@JvmName(name = "gqcsgnlaecrwngrb")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"egkbvarrctnbcarx")
suspend fun grafanaVersion(value: Output<String>)
@JvmName(name = "kfrqxlpwppugdppo")
suspend fun grafanaVersion(value: String?)
Link copied to clipboard
@JvmName(name = "ljmieeurfnugnweh")
suspend fun name(value: Output<String>)
@JvmName(name = "qhrkuvncwqnxcehx")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"tbiqypwlwoqcbyid")
suspend fun networkAccessControl(value: WorkspaceNetworkAccessControlArgs?)
@JvmName(name = "wlorcvlvfiaiihry")
suspend fun networkAccessControl(value: Output<WorkspaceNetworkAccessControlArgs>)
@JvmName(name = "hagrllytvgsiyhhx")
suspend fun networkAccessControl(argument: suspend WorkspaceNetworkAccessControlAr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"lqnrnjyrolhtrxyi")
suspend fun notificationDestinations(value: Output<List<WorkspaceNotificationDestinationType>>)
@JvmName(name = "vxvgtfxixfjvgvrt")
suspend fun notificationDestinations(vararg values: WorkspaceNotificationDestinationType)
@JvmName(name = "qdgplklepslxdjpv")
suspend fun notificationDestinations(vararg values: Output<WorkspaceNotificationDestinationType>)
@JvmName(name = "lcmpbjgxhjkgxmto")
suspend fun notificationDestinations(value: List<WorkspaceNotificationDestinationType>?)
@JvmName(name = "gmlkhsiltmkrckch")
suspend fun notificationDestinations(values: List<Output<WorkspaceNotificationDestinationType>>)
Link copied to clipboard
@JvmName(name = "xvfwthsfigstmuaq")
suspend fun organizationalUnits(value: Output<List<String>>)
@JvmName(name = "ksnsrsvshueufdok")
suspend fun organizationalUnits(vararg values: Output<String>)
@JvmName(name = "gqfonbluflyyrwyr")
suspend fun organizationalUnits(vararg values: String)
@JvmName(name = "cyvwyjwoclhynwcn")
suspend fun organizationalUnits(values: List<Output<String>>)
@JvmName(name = "fmgwtrsmgvuhqlcc")
suspend fun organizationalUnits(value: List<String>?)
Link copied to clipboard
@JvmName(name = "kfxpexaiylgcleup")
suspend fun organizationRoleName(value: Output<String>)
@JvmName(name = "qtwdvhtsbbmtsvwn")
suspend fun organizationRoleName(value: String?)
Link copied to clipboard
@JvmName(name = "bovjdqvqfcfljnbv")
suspend fun permissionType(value: WorkspacePermissionType?)
@JvmName(name = "sqbvhxabxnsoxcro")
suspend fun permissionType(value: Output<WorkspacePermissionType>)
Link copied to clipboard
@JvmName(name = "dclndodiicveckfh")
suspend fun pluginAdminEnabled(value: Output<Boolean>)
@JvmName(name = "ummjjclrjqhgklnl")
suspend fun pluginAdminEnabled(value: Boolean?)
Link copied to clipboard
@JvmName(name = "jicdfievaogxngdd")
suspend fun roleArn(value: Output<String>)
@JvmName(name = "ctosvmgqglorahbs")
suspend fun roleArn(value: String?)
Link copied to clipboard
@JvmName(name = "hnnrvonlddugjlob")
suspend fun samlConfiguration(value: WorkspaceSamlConfigurationArgs?)
@JvmName(name = "ttvwhdjajurtutsp")
suspend fun samlConfiguration(value: Output<WorkspaceSamlConfigurationArgs>)
@JvmName(name = "ghgdfcgnumrvdism")
suspend fun samlConfiguration(argument: suspend WorkspaceSamlConfiguration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"bjsjwtkenpqkwegr")
suspend fun stackSetName(value: Output<String>)
@JvmName(name = "lnwbsdkqexnlkxua")
suspend fun stackSetName(value: String?)
Link copied to clipboard
@JvmName(name = "ygtkdpqpwxtwtmqm")
suspend fun vpcConfiguration(value: WorkspaceVpcConfigurationArgs?)
@JvmName(name = "ihbswecrlofjcpyh")
suspend fun vpcConfiguration(value: Output<WorkspaceVpcConfigurationArgs>)
@JvmName(name = "cbpwfbhbvloqrwgo")
suspend fun vpcConfiguration(argument: suspend WorkspaceVpcConfigurationArgsBuilder.() -> Unit)